Skip to content
Projects
Groups
Snippets
Help
Loading...
Sign in
Toggle navigation
F
ffm-baseline
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
ML
ffm-baseline
Commits
e81a83ab
Commit
e81a83ab
authored
Oct 12, 2019
by
张彦钊
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
change
parent
80a52b52
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
26 additions
and
2 deletions
+26
-2
meigou.py
local/meigou.py
+1
-1
make_data.py
make_data.py
+25
-1
No files found.
local/meigou.py
View file @
e81a83ab
...
@@ -282,7 +282,7 @@ if __name__ == '__main__':
...
@@ -282,7 +282,7 @@ if __name__ == '__main__':
spark
=
SparkSession
.
builder
.
config
(
conf
=
sparkConf
)
.
enableHiveSupport
()
.
getOrCreate
()
spark
=
SparkSession
.
builder
.
config
(
conf
=
sparkConf
)
.
enableHiveSupport
()
.
getOrCreate
()
for
os
in
[
"ios"
,
"android"
]:
for
os
in
[
"ios"
,
"android"
]:
all_list
=
[]
all_list
=
[]
for
i
in
range
(
1
,
27
):
for
i
in
range
(
1
,
3
):
date_str
=
(
datetime
.
date
.
today
()
-
datetime
.
timedelta
(
days
=
i
))
.
strftime
(
"
%
Y
%
m
%
d"
)
date_str
=
(
datetime
.
date
.
today
()
-
datetime
.
timedelta
(
days
=
i
))
.
strftime
(
"
%
Y
%
m
%
d"
)
tmp_list
=
[
date_str
]
tmp_list
=
[
date_str
]
tmp_list
.
extend
(
os_all_click
(
i
,
os
))
tmp_list
.
extend
(
os_all_click
(
i
,
os
))
...
...
make_data.py
View file @
e81a83ab
import
redis
import
redis
import
json
import
datetime
def
make_queue
():
native
=
"58,59,60,61,62,63,64,65"
r
.
hset
(
key
,
"native_queue"
,
native
)
nearby
=
'88,89,90,91,92,93,94,95'
r
.
hset
(
key
,
"nearby_queue"
,
nearby
)
nation
=
'128,129,130,131,132,133,134,135,136,137,138,139'
r
.
hset
(
key
,
"nation_queue"
,
nation
)
megacity
=
'150,151,152,153,154,155,156,157,158,159'
r
.
hset
(
key
,
"megacity_queue"
,
megacity
)
def
user_portr
():
key
=
'user_portrait_recommend_diary_queue:device_id:
%
s:
%
s'
%
\
(
device_id
,
datetime
.
datetime
.
now
()
.
strftime
(
'
%
Y-
%
m-
%
d'
))
r
.
hset
(
key
,
"cursor"
,
"0"
)
r
.
hset
(
key
,
"len_cursor"
,
"0"
)
r
.
hset
(
key
,
"cpc_queue"
,
json
.
dumps
([
58
,
59
,
60
,
61
,
62
,
63
,
64
,
65
]))
r
.
hset
(
key
,
"diary_queue"
,
json
.
dumps
([
88
,
89
,
90
,
91
,
92
,
93
,
94
,
95
]))
print
(
r
.
hgetall
(
key
))
if
__name__
==
"__main__"
:
if
__name__
==
"__main__"
:
topic_key
()
device_id
=
"860445048868273"
user_portr
()
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ment